Shuttle-bus gate, Pellerin Court south side. Reception: the gate opens for scheduled shuttles only, 07:00–19:00. Visitors arriving by shuttle must still sign in at the main desk — no direct building entry from the gate. Drivers do not handle passes. If the gate sensor fails, open it manually from the panel. The panel requires the staff code below.

door code, yagap-bahof: bdg-O-05

**Ticket: Feed validator creds expired (again)**

Heads up for the weekly sync — the Podforge feed validator has been silently skipping remote fetch checks since Monday because its credential for the internal fetch proxy, Snagline, expired over the weekend. Nobody noticed because the validator reports "skipped" as a pass. We should fix that reporting bug separately. In the meantime I've provisioned a replacement credential so the nightly validation runs can resume; the new one is below.

gateway credential: zpat3_i6x

# Data Stores: Greenhouse Controller (Vinewarden)

Quick note on sensor drift: the humidity probes in Bay 3 drift upward about 2% per month, so Vinewarden applies a rolling calibration offset stored alongside raw readings. Don't "fix" raw values — downstream recalibration depends on them. Readings and offsets live in the telemetry database, reachable via the connection string below.

replica DSN, yahaf-yagaf: mongodb://tamath_svc:a2netSk3RZMuTj@db-d084.novacsoft.internal:5432/ralmir

## Deploying SquatSniff

Hey, welcome aboard! SquatSniff scans our internal registry for typo-squatting lookalikes of popular package names. Deployment is just a container push plus a config reload — no database migrations, promise. Staging first, always. Once the image is live, the scanner picks up these configuration values on startup.

deployment values, yahag-tawef:
ZORWYN_HOST=zorwyn.tolvaqlabs.internal
ZORWYN_PORT=9300